This concentrate has the consistency of maple syrup and the flavor of tart cherries. It can be used like pomegranate molasses in marinades and sauces.
More Culinary ApplicationsThis concentrate can suppress lipid oxidation and bind moisture when used in meat and poultry marinades. The suggested usage levels for moisture binding is between .5% to 1.1% of the weight of the meat block.
More Meat / Poultry ApplicationsAdded in small quantities, this concentrate can subtly enhance the caramelization of light-colored baked goods, such as lemon pound cake, madeleines, and gluten-free muffins. It can also help suppress rancidity in whole-grain baked goods.
